There are a few factors to consider when spending skill points, as well as caveats. Skill trees can only be unlocked by finding specific items in the world. But once you’ve found the proper item, you can invest skill points at a rest area known as the Sculptor’s Idol (Sekiro’s version of a bonfire). Of the skill trees revealed, we have shinobi Arts, Samurai Arts, and a tree dedicated to the prosthetic arm. Shinobi arts is about stealth gameplay and crowd control. Samurai, on the other hand, lets you assault opponents head-on. Alongside passive abilities and buffs, “combat arts”, as From Software mentioned, are moves that let you further customize playstyle.
